How Cash Back Programs Really Work
Cash back at online casinos operates on a simple principle: you get a percentage of your net losses returned as bonus funds or real cash. Unlike traditional bonuses that require upfront deposits, cash back kicks in after you've already played, making it a safety net rather than an entry incentive.
Most programs calculate your net losses over a specific period—daily, weekly, or monthly—then credit back anywhere from 5% to 25% of those losses. The beauty lies in the timing: you're getting value from money you've already spent, essentially extending your playing time without reaching deeper into your wallet.

The Mathematics Behind Your Returns
Understanding the numbers helps you maximize these offers. If you experience $200 in net losses during a promotional period with a 10% cash back rate, you'll receive $20 back. This might seem modest, but consider the compound effect: that $20 gives you additional chances to win, potentially turning a losing session into a profitable one.
The key difference between cash back and other bonuses lies in the risk-reward calculation. Traditional deposit bonuses require you to risk new money, while cash back rewards money you've already committed to play. This creates a more favorable risk profile for players who understand bankroll management.

Maximizing Your Cash Back Value
Smart players treat cash back as part of their overall bankroll management strategy. Rather than viewing returned funds as "free money," consider them as extended playing capital with specific rules attached. Most cash back comes with playthrough requirements—typically 30x the bonus amount—meaning you'll need to wager that money several times before withdrawal.
The 30-day expiration window common to most programs creates urgency without being restrictive. This timeframe allows for natural gaming patterns while preventing bonus accumulation that never gets used. Planning your sessions around these expiration dates ensures you capture maximum value from every cash back credit.
